I'm a Filipino in the Philippines. I'm planning to visit North Korea through the help of a travel agency station in Beijing. I'll need to get to Beijing to also have the travel arrangements to NoKor be taken care of. Will a tourist visa suffice?

Why don't you apply for visa to North Korea at Embassy of North Korea in Phillipines, if North Korea doesn't establish any diplomatic missions in Phillipines, I think that you can hold a tourist visa to Beijing in order to apply for visa to North Korea, however, now Filipinos are very hard to get a Chinese tourist visa to China.
